Lufthansa Group reports revenue surge in first half of 2018
Despite the implementation of the International Financial Reporting Standards' (IFRS) 15 accounting standard, German airline Lufthansa recorded a 5.2% increase in its revenue in the first half of 2018. The airline's adjusted EBIT (earnings before interest and taxes) margin is at 6% in comparison to 6.1% in the first half year of 2017.
Lufthansa also reported a record number of passengers carried for the period; 67 million. The airline also managed to reduce its unit costs by 0.6%, as a result of the efficiency enhancements at its subsidiary passenger airline Network Airlines.
